A PROPOSAL to upgrade a house in a Hampshire town has been withdrawn by the applicant.

New Forest District Council (NFDC) is no longer studying an application to build a single storey extension to a large detached house at West Hayes in Lymington.

Lymington and Pennington Council had urged NFDC to reject the proposal.

In a letter to the authority it said the proposed development would detract from the attractive design of the house and was not in keeping with the character of the area.

The applicants submitted plans to build a new addition and remove an existing conservatory.

The application said: "A modern approach has been taken to achieve a less cluttered and more symmetrical design.

"It is felt that the proposals respond positively to the opportunity to make better use of the site, improve and increase the living space."
